  • All-round carefree package for residual moisture analysis
    Residual moisture is particularly a problem in polar, hydrophil plastics which can even sometimes break down in water. But a precise
    identifi cation of the water content of unpolar, hydrophobic polymers can also help to make the difficult drying and manufacturing process more economical.

     

    The AQUATRAC Station is e.g. suited to analysing the following materials: 

    • Thermoplasts, such as ABS, PBT, PA 6.6, PA 6, e.g. GF30, PA 12, PC, PET, TPE, PEI, LDPE, HDPE, PETP, PMMA, PP etc.
    • Duroplasts, such as epoxy resin, acrylates, silicon resin, vinyl resin etc.
    • Elastomers, such as styrene-butadien rubber (SBR), polychloroprene rubber (CR), thermoplastic polyurethane (TPU) etc.
  • Measurement principle / test methods: Dew point measurement / Precise residual moisture calculation, temperature scan
    Sample weight / sample volume 0.05 – 10 g dependent on the expected residual moisture proportion / max. 50  cm3
    Solution 0.01 mg / 1 ppm / 0.0001 % H2O
    Measurement range 0.01 – 30 mg H2O (absolute) / 1 ppm – 99.9 % H2O (relative)
    Precision / Reproducibility + 0.02 mg H2O / + 0.03 mg H2O
    Temperature range 30 – 200 °C in steps of 1 °C
    Measuring time / measurement result in 5 – 600 min / mg, ppm, %
    Abort criteria Increase in residual moisture proportion (standard + user defined)

    Exceeding of the upper processing threshold (user defined)

    Failure to reach the lower processing threshold after a specific period (user defined)

    Fixed measurement period (user defined)
    Voltage / frequency / Rated output 100 – 240 VAC ± 10 % / 50 – 60 Hz / max. 600 W
    Interfaces 3 × USB 2.0, 1 × Ethernet
    Calibration Multi-point calibration, retraceability to averages based on NIST and UKAS standards
    Ambient temperature 10 - 40 °C
    Air humidity 10 - 90 % non-condensing
    Dimensions (L × W × H) / Weight 562 × 404 × 275 mm / 27.6 kg
